Output 103d60b074fe21855a5a2d212fde45e0d1b3b93ffdae4cfc975cd3d4e29f93b2:1

value
1013619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e12f6b5b9596ae7ec9614e950085905d142f17b9 OP_EQUAL
address
3NDgmTgoS3uD8vKodSSZngfEDWLfk7G1zA
transaction
103d60b074fe21855a5a2d212fde45e0d1b3b93ffdae4cfc975cd3d4e29f93b2
confirmations
396826
spent
true